a man page is not available after installing by "texlive-localmanager"

I need documentation for "latexmk", so I ran "tllocalmgr installdoc latexmk" from "texlive-localmanager-git" as recommended in the wiki. I rejected the package "texlive-most-doc" because it is huge. After running the command, a package "texlive-local-latexmk-doc" appeared. It contains the file "/usr/local/share/texmf/doc/man/man1/latexmk.1". I guess that this is the desired man page. However,

>man latexmk
No manual entry for latexmk

I tried to relogin. I guess that "/usr/local/share/texmf/doc/man/man1" should be added to some environment variable?

BTW, "tllocalmgr" can't be run as root, but it requires root password somewhere in the middle. It does not make sense to me. Why not run it as root? It can reduce privileges for its subprocesses.

Re: a man page is not available after installing by "texlive-localmanager"

Maybe something went wrong with tllocalmgr, the easiest solution is to copy latexmk.1 to /usr/local/share/man/man1, then run mandb as root. Alternatively you could try adding the file's path to MANPATH, although as far as I know that shouldn't be necessary.

The reason it requires a root password is probably to run mandb, and the reason you can't run the whole command as root is probably that it needs to access some of your user's environment variables - I could be wrong though.
